THE QUEEN-ST. WELL.

[to tat editor op THE DAILY.]' Sir,—At. a recent meeting of the Borougli Council Cr Gapper stated: the cost of the well in Queon-st, to be .£2O. Allow me to correct this statemerit. The original cost of-it was ,£8 7s 3d, but in consequence of the Council allowing the pipe to remain uncovered it was filled with stones, by mischievous boyß, and had to bo drawn und cleared at a second cost of £3 Is; but taking both these charges into account they only make £ll 8s 3d, not 120 as alleged. Yours obediently, S. Kingdom
